More than 2 tons of fat and animal skin of unknown origin discovered in Gia Lai

Hoài Phương |

Gia Lai - Functional forces discovered and temporarily seized more than 2 tons of animal fat and skin of unknown origin at a food processing facility in Quy Nhon ward.

On July 7, Market Management Team No. 5 (Gia Lai Provincial Market Management Sub-Department) coordinated with the Economic Police Department of Gia Lai Provincial Police and functional forces of Quy Nhon Ward to inspect business household T.L. Y. N (residing in Quarter 57, Quy Nhon Ward).

This business household is registered to operate in the fields of wholesale of food (meat and fat), processing, preserving meat and meat products.

Through inspection, functional forces discovered more than 2 tons of animal fat and skin gathered at the facility. The household owner could not present invoices, documents or papers proving the origin of all raw materials.

At the scene, the processing and storage area of raw materials did not ensure food safety and hygiene conditions. Many bags containing fat and animal skin were placed directly on the dirty floor.

Functional forces also discovered 16 20-liter plastic cans containing a liquid suspected to be oil produced from animal fat and skin.

In addition, the floor is greasy and dirty, the production space is damp, tools and materials are arranged in a mixed way, not meeting food safety and hygiene requirements.

Functional forces have made a record and temporarily seized all 2 tons of animal fat and skin along with related exhibits to serve the verification and handling according to regulations. At the same time, continue to clarify the origin of the raw materials and the compliance with food safety regulations of the establishment.
